Feedback loops in the hypothalamic-anterior pituitary pathways are complex endocrine reexes with 3 integrating centres. Long-loop negative feedback is the dominant form of negative feedback in the hypothalamic-anterior pituitary pathway where the hormone secreted by the peripheral endocrine gland suppresses secretion of its anterior pituitary and hypothalamic hormones Short-loop negative feedback in the hypothalamic-anterior pituitary pathway occurs when an anterior pituitary hormone feeds back to decrease hormone secretion by the hypothalamus.
